首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 查看磁盘为只读

在Linux系统中,如果遇到磁盘显示为只读的情况,可能是由于多种原因造成的。以下是一些基础概念、可能的原因、解决方案以及相关的应用场景。

基础概念

  • 只读文件系统:文件系统的一种状态,其中数据可以被读取,但不能被修改或删除。
  • 文件系统检查:通常使用fsck工具来检查和修复Linux文件系统中的错误。

可能的原因

  1. 文件系统损坏:磁盘上的文件系统可能因为意外断电、硬件故障或其他原因而损坏。
  2. 权限问题:当前用户可能没有足够的权限来修改磁盘上的文件。
  3. 挂载选项:磁盘可能被挂载为只读模式。

解决方案

检查文件系统状态

使用mount命令查看磁盘的挂载状态:

代码语言:txt
复制
mount | grep /dev/sdXn

其中/dev/sdXn是你的磁盘设备标识。

重新挂载为读写模式

如果磁盘被错误地挂载为只读,可以尝试重新挂载为读写模式:

代码语言:txt
复制
sudo mount -o remount,rw /dev/sdXn /mount/point

这里/dev/sdXn是磁盘设备标识,/mount/point是挂载点。

运行文件系统检查

如果怀疑文件系统损坏,可以使用fsck工具进行检查和修复:

代码语言:txt
复制
sudo fsck /dev/sdXn

在运行fsck之前,请确保磁盘没有被挂载,否则可能会造成数据丢失。

应用场景

  • 服务器维护:在服务器维护过程中,可能需要检查或修复文件系统。
  • 数据恢复:在数据丢失或损坏的情况下,可能需要通过检查和修复文件系统来尝试恢复数据。
  • 系统部署:在部署新系统或更新现有系统时,可能需要确保文件系统的完整性。

示例代码

假设你的磁盘设备是/dev/sdb1,挂载点是/mnt/data,以下是一系列操作的示例:

  1. 查看挂载状态:
  2. 查看挂载状态:
  3. 如果显示为只读,重新挂载为读写:
  4. 如果显示为只读,重新挂载为读写:
  5. 如果重新挂载失败,运行文件系统检查:
  6. 如果重新挂载失败,运行文件系统检查:

通过上述步骤,通常可以解决Linux系统中磁盘显示为只读的问题。如果问题仍然存在,可能需要进一步检查硬件状态或寻求专业的技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分37秒

110_Linux之磁盘IO查看iostat和pidstat

10分21秒

051_尚硅谷课程系列之Linux_实操篇_磁盘管理类(二)_查看磁盘使用情况

10分21秒

051_尚硅谷课程系列之Linux_实操篇_磁盘管理类(二)_查看磁盘使用情况

47秒

怎么将磁盘图标设置为女朋友照片

11分5秒

088-influxd命令-查看磁盘数据与数据迁出

10分34秒

052_尚硅谷课程系列之Linux_实操篇_磁盘管理类(三)_查看设备挂载情况

10分34秒

052_尚硅谷课程系列之Linux_实操篇_磁盘管理类(三)_查看设备挂载情况

1时25分

1Linux基础知识-8磁盘管理-1磁盘相关概念

33分20秒

06-1-Linux系统磁盘管理

28分1秒

06-2-Linux系统磁盘管理

10分55秒

050_尚硅谷课程系列之Linux_实操篇_磁盘管理类(一)_查看目录占用空间大小

10分55秒

050_尚硅谷课程系列之Linux_实操篇_磁盘管理类(一)_查看目录占用空间大小

领券